Karnataka’s Twin Waterfalls Barachukki & Gaganachukki Mesmerise Netizens

Nestled near the island town of Shivanasamudra in Karnataka, Barachukki and Gaganachukki are two spell-binding twin waterfalls. Water from the river Cauvery flows down a 75-metre gorge and divides the waterfall into two parts. They later flow through deep ravines forming two waterfalls- Barachukki and Gaganachukki which flows around Shivanasamudra. Just a few kilometres apart from each other, the two cascading waterfalls is a sight to behold.

Pictures and videos of the twin waterfalls are doing the rounds on social media. Watching the waterfalls flowing next to each other, it resembles white milk flowing down the hills. In fact, Shivanasamudra,the region where the waterfalls are located, itself means Shiva’s Sea. Barachukki and Gaganachukki waterfalls are considered to be among the 100 best in the world.
